Since ba3e76c,
the optimizer call generate_useful_gather_paths instead of 
generate_gather_paths() outside.

But I noticed that some comment still talking about generate_gather_paths not 
generate_useful_gather_paths.
I think we should fix these comment, and I try to replace these " generate_gather_paths " 
with " generate_useful_gather_paths "


Thanks. I started looking at this a bit more closely, and I think most of the changes are fine - the code was changed to call a different function, but the comments still reference generate_gather_paths().

The one exception seems to be create_ordered_paths(), because that comment also makes statements about what generate_gather_pathes is doing. And some of it does not apply to generate_useful_gather_paths. For example it says it generates order-preserving Gather Merge paths, but generate_useful_gather_paths also generates paths with sorts (which are clearly not order-preserving).

So I think this comment will need a bit more work to update ...
